It works on Android too!
Just install the beta Firefox, install the add-on and you will have an additional menu item named Passman (the last on the list).
Now access it and you will get the same menu as on desktop but in a separate tab. The issue here is that it is not optimized for mobile so you will have to zoom manually or even span to see the actual input fields for the first setup (it is in the upper left corner).
